Output 759cf7a08b64cf890fd52a54f7ce7fe8720f9c6560d89829ab3d75c153b914e2:2

value
287500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f788221d8253f40e86e53c7c793e65bc297c4a98 OP_EQUAL
address
3QFqudYDoXw5pCZYmsm3PmLAmom4ck188R
transaction
759cf7a08b64cf890fd52a54f7ce7fe8720f9c6560d89829ab3d75c153b914e2
confirmations
366068
spent
true